Tim has been the
Program's Instructional Assistant since October 1992. He
is an alumni of the Program, holding an AAS Degree in Communication
Design and Electronic Graphic Design. Tim assists students
and faculty in the classroom and individually.
Before attending NVCC Tim worked
ten years with his father, Don Brockman, an American saddle
horse, trainer. At that time Brockman Stables was located
in Neenah, Wisconsin. Tim spent a winter helping an uncle
film Point Ryes National Seashore and then moved on to earn
a "Six Pack" - Charter Boat Skippers License for
power or sail on the eastern side of Lake Michigan. Being
around boats and good repairing them he eventually went to
work for Nimphius Boats, Neshkoro, and later the Boat Works
in Oshkosh and later still, Sweetwater Boats also of Neshkoro.
All these boat yards were located in Wisconsin.
When lean
times hit the boat building world Tim became a carpenter.
After several years on construction sites, circumstances
changed. Drawing and painting became the focus for several
years. When illustration peaked his interest he found his
way to the Communication Design Program at the Alexandria
Campus. That was more than 12 years ago.
